We are looking for a Production General Foreman to join Kaiser Aluminum Warrick Operations in Newburgh, Indiana! The General Foreman will be responsible for the 24/7 operation of the crews in their respective area and participate in projects in other areas. The successful candidate will be accountable for Environmental, Health, and Safety results, productivity improvements, employee development, maximizing the value of diversity, and customer delivery through implementation of Lean manufacturing principles, including Kaizen, Daily Management, TPM, 5S, Problem Solving, etc. He/she They will ensure consistent implementation and execution of policies and systems in order to guarantee customer (internal and external) expectations are met at the lowest cost and always with safety at the forefront of every activity. The General Foreman will work within Department Lead Teams and with peers in other departments to assure overall plant success. The Area Coordinator will work to ensure the execution of any of the financial goals and expectations set for each respective year. The Area Coordinator This individual will be responsible for planning and sometimes leading Kaizens, TPM, and safety events in his/her their areas. He/she They will be responsible for coaching and counseling front-line supervisors and any other staff personnel in his/her Pack Ship area or as assigned.

Kaiser is proud to be an equal opportunity workplace and is an affirmative action employer. Kaiser Aluminum Corporation is a leading producer of semi-fabricated aluminum products. Manufacturers and major suppliers around the world look to Kaiser to deliver highly engineered solutions for their most demanding aerospace, automotive and industrial applications. The reason is simple: we adhere to the same strong commitments to quality, innovation and service today as when the company was founded in 1946. Kaiser operates 12 production facilities across North America. Collectively, these facilities allow us to produce an impressive range of value-added plate, sheet, and extruded products. This latter category includes extruded shapes as well as rod, bar, tube, forged stock and wire products. Each of our facilities specializes in manufacturing products for specific industries, allowing us to not only develop a deeper understanding of each market but also differentiate our processes to more efficiently meet the needs of our customers operating in those markets.
